blk: blkmap: Support mapping to device of any block size
At present if a device to map has a block size other than 512, the blkmap map process just fails. There is no reason why we can't just use the block size of the mapped device. Signed-off-by: Bin Meng <bmeng@tinylab.org> Reviewed-by: Simon Glass <sjg@chromium.org>
